**Summary** The Whatcom County is seeking a highly organized, detail-oriented Administrative Secretary/Grants Coordinator to support the Executive's Office with a wide range of administrative, document-management, and grant-related functions. This position handles confidential information, works with minimal supervision, and plays a key role in keeping office operations efficient and compliant.Key job duties include:Provides comprehensive administrative support, including complex clerical, bookkeeping, and secretarial duties.Manages high-volume document workflows using Laserfiche, DocuSign, and County document management systems; troubleshoots issues and maintain records, databases, and archives.Coordinates boards and commissions processes, maintain rosters, and serve as Clerk for assigned boards.Serves as a primary point of contact for the public and internal departments; answer inquiries, resolve issues, and provide excellent customer service.Supports agenda management: maintain calendars, schedule meetings, arrange travel, and review agenda items for the Executive's Office.Interprets and applies policies, procedures, and regulations to ensure compliance across assigned responsibilities.Prepares edits, and tracks contracts, grants, agreements, correspondence, and reports.Coordinates countywide grant opportunities: assist departments with funding research, application preparation, compliance review, and documentation.Monitors grant and contract budgets, tracks expenditures, and ensures timely reimbursement submissions.Conducts research, compiles data, and prepares financial, budget, and grant reports.Processes accounts receivable, supports payroll and purchasing tasks, and assists with other financial documentation.Supervisor: Deputy Executive Hours of Work: Monday - Friday 8 AM - 5 PMFor more information please review the**Qualifications** Requires a high school diploma or GED AND four years of progressively responsible administrative, technical or office support experienceORAssociate's degree in a related field and two years of progressively responsible administrative, technical or office support or other relevant experience;Required experience must include working with document management systems, financial processing software and technical applications.**Desired Qualifications:** Completion of office management, bookkeeping or information systems courses beyond the high school level.Knowledge of governmental accounting standards and integrated financial management systems.Knowledge of protocol for public meetings, county ordinances and organizational structure, functions, officials and political environments of local county government.At its sole discretion, Whatcom County may consider combinations of education, experience, certifications, and training in lieu of specifically required qualifications contained herein.Ideal candidates will demonstrate: * Experience performing complex administrative or program support duties in a governmental or similar environment. * Proficiency with electronic document management systems (Laserfiche, DocuSign, or comparable tools). * Knowledge of grant administration, contract processes, or financial tracking. * Strong organizational, communication, and customer-service skills. * Ability to interpret and apply policies, procedures, and regulations. * Ability to manage multiple priorities and work independently with limited direction. * Ability to maintain confidentiality and handle sensitive information appropriately. **Supplemental Information** **Salary Range:** * Wages scheduled to increase 2.75% in January 2026 and another 2.5% in January 2027.
